#741cc8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#741cc8 is composed of 45.5% red, 11%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42% cyan, 86%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 270.7 degrees, a saturation of 75.4% and a lightness of 44.7%. #741cc8 color hex could be obtained by blending #e838ff with #000091.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

Shades and Tints of #741cc8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#06020b is the darkest color, while #fbf9f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#741cc8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#726b79 is the less saturated color, while #7502e2 is the most saturated one.
